Welspun Corp Increases Stake in Subsidiary Welspun Specialty Solutions to 55.17%
Welspun Corp Limited completed the acquisition of 4.11% equity shares in its subsidiary, Welspun Specialty Solutions Limited, for approximately ₹108.96 crores. This increases Welspun Corp's stake in WSSL from 51.06% to 55.17%. The transaction was finalized on December 22, 2025.

Welspun Corp Limited (WELCORP) announced the successful completion of its acquisition of 2,72,39,744 equity shares, representing 4.11% of the total equity, in its subsidiary, Welspun Specialty Solutions Limited (WSSL). The shares were acquired from the existing Promoter Group, MGN Agro Properties Private Limited and Welspun Group Master Trust, at the prevailing market price.
The acquisition was completed today, 22 December 2025, through a block deal for an aggregate consideration of approximately ₹108.96 crores.
Following this transaction, Welspun Corp's equity shareholding in WSSL has increased from 51.06% to 55.17%. The aggregate holding of the Promoter and Promoter Group remains unchanged before and after this acquisition.
